Output c84c621e7b5a87a124a2aa46fec3f047b7a55b9211d0d304e75b2ea0b3ccc86a:0

value
69509235
script pubkey
OP_0 OP_PUSHBYTES_20 8504940592c207a68cedd6aaac1a8d390afc5227
address
bc1qs5zfgpvjcgr6dr8d6642cx5d8y90c538c9nc4u
transaction
c84c621e7b5a87a124a2aa46fec3f047b7a55b9211d0d304e75b2ea0b3ccc86a